The Great Central Railway Route Highlights
The steam powered train departs from Loughborough Central Railway Station and travels to 1940’s Quorn & Woodhouse station, Swithland reservoir, 1912 gas lit Rothley station and Leicester North Station before turning back. It is a scenic route and perfect for taking in the Leicestershire countryside and takes around 3 hours for the full journey. (Over the Festive Period, times are shorter).
On route you can see the locomotive change ends (which is fascinating). It also gives you a chance to get off the heritage steam railway and stretch your legs.

Santa Express Route
The Santa Express lasts about 1hr 30 minutes. It will pass through Quorn, Rothley, Swithland Reservoir and Leicester North Station where it will stop for 25 minutes so you can visit the Vintage Tea room, take some photos in the photo booth and get photos of the locomotive with Santa.

What accessibility is there on the train
One coach is accessible and suitable for wheelchairs. Please contact the Railway for more details. Guide dogs are allowed on the train too.

The Great Central Railway is Britain’s only preserved double track mainline railway and is preserved by dedicated volunteers.
